You get your text from the textarea and you do this:

Dynamically attach a movieclip from the library with a preformatted
textfield that exactly fits an A4 page (set movieclip to _visible = false to
do it invisibly)
and fill the textfield up with the text from your textarea until the
textfield is full.

Then you add to movieclip to the printjob and push the reference to the
movieclip to an array. 

Cut the remaining text and fill up the next one...
Create a loop of this to write out all your text.

After all text is written out, you execute the printjob and remove all 
the movieclips with removeMovieClip by looping the array of movieclips.

NOTE : this is easier than it seems.

Subject: [Flashcoders] PRINTJOB HELL, PRINTJOB NIGHTMARE with several PAGES

Hi.
I wanted to Print contents of a long Scrollable textArea  with Flash, but
it's a kind of nightmare.

I tried to made a class to manage Printing (with a PrintJob object inside) ,
and one empty swf that Creates Dynamically the TextArea and the Class to
ManagePrinting, who feeds textArea with contents and scroll TextArea adding
page by page contents.

Problems:

- The Scrolled area in Screen doesn't appeared to be the same than the
printable area (each Page, i see repeated contents... why? i just don't know
. IT's like the scroll doesn't scroll propertly).

- Of course, sometimes, appeared incomplete text (with a cut at the middle)
because i don't know any mechanism to avoid it at the moment.


Somebody have any idea -> the contents to print will be sometimes of 5 or 6
pages DIN A-4

thanks in advance
